Skip to content

Главная

Однажды я буду благодарен себе за то, что начал вести эту документацию!

Привет!

Это моя личная база знаний, где я собираю полезные команды, код, сниппеты и решения.

Буду называть это своим конспектом для усвоения материала!

И также неплохой опыт в целом по тому, как вести документацию.

Потому что мало просто написать хороший код, важно сделать его понятным другим разработчикам без слов.

Иначе велик шанс стать тем самым закоренелым сотрудником, которого компания боится потерять не по причине того что он очень скилловый, а по причине - "Никто кроме него не знает как это должно работать..."

    Какие изначально бонусы в этом я для себя вижу:
  • Навык ведения документации
  • Личная база знаний к которой можно обращаться
  • Иметь возможность поделиться с другими разработчиками в понятном виде
  • Лучшее понимание своего же кода (self review)
  • При написании доки к своим же проектам, иметь возможность вернуться к ним спустя месяц, и точно знать куда лезть чтобы вспомнить как что-либо работает

P.S. Многое из базовых принципов языков/фреймворков у меня уже давно задокументировано в голове, поэтому слишком банальные вещи я тут не стал описывать, скорее всё то, что слишком часто используется (для быстрого доступа). Иначе это заняло бы очень большое количество времени, которое вместо этого можно потратить на программирование и изучение чего-то нового.